• 售前

  • 售后

热门帖子
入门百科

八步办理ACCESS主动编号问题(将SQL SERVER 2000数据库,转换为ACCESS数据库)

[复制链接]
落败的青春阳落s 显示全部楼层 发表于 2021-8-14 14:51:16 |阅读模式 打印 上一主题 下一主题
第一步:打开你的"开始菜单",打开“步伐”-》SQL server enterprise mananger "企业管理器"
在你要导出的SQL数据库上鼠标右键菜单:所有任务-》导出数据

第二步:会出现一个导出向导窗口。
选择被导出的数据源,为你刚才所选择的数据库,如果发现不对应自行修改。

第三步:进入导出到目的数据源的选择,这里我们要转成ACCESS的数据库。注意选择数据源类型为“Microsoft Access。点 “文件名(F)” 后面的按钮选择目的.MDB文件。


第四步:选择“从数据库复制表和视图”。

第五步:我们注意这里选表的时间右边有一个“转换”列。SQL导出只转换数据类型并不思量其他脚本以是我们碰到的自动编号问题也就出在这里。有自动编号的一定要点选“转换”。

第六步:我们回看到一个“列映射和转换”对话框。有注意到自增的employeeid int 自增这里变成了Access里的long这肯定不对,long并不是自动编号,只好修改建表脚本,图片上谁人红圈里的按钮“编辑SQL”。

开一个小窗create talbe

红圈中的脚本就是employeeid 的 Access建表脚本,在 "NOT NULL" 前面加上 "IDENTITY (1, 1)"。

第七步:立即实行。

下图表示建表复制已成功

第八步:我们打开MDB文件看看是不是如我们所愿?

OK完成,恭喜你利用成功

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

帖子地址: 

回复

使用道具 举报

分享
推广
火星云矿 | 预约S19Pro,享500抵1000!
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

草根技术分享(草根吧)是全球知名中文IT技术交流平台,创建于2021年,包含原创博客、精品问答、职业培训、技术社区、资源下载等产品服务,提供原创、优质、完整内容的专业IT技术开发社区。
  • 官方手机版

  • 微信公众号

  • 商务合作